public class ShapeGroup
extends java.lang.Object
implements java.lang.AutoCloseable
| Modifier and Type | Field and Description |
|---|---|
protected boolean |
swigCMemOwn |
| Modifier | Constructor and Description |
|---|---|
protected |
ShapeGroup(long cPtr,
boolean cMemoryOwn) |
|
ShapeGroup(ShapeGroup shape_group) |
| Modifier and Type | Method and Description |
|---|---|
void |
close() |
void |
delete() |
protected void |
finalize() |
protected static long |
getCPtr(ShapeGroup obj) |
int |
getKey()
Shape group identifier.
|
java.lang.String |
getLabel()
Shape group label.
|
java.util.Map<java.lang.String,java.lang.String> |
getMeta()
Shape group meta data.
|
boolean |
isEnabled()
Enable flag.
|
boolean |
isSelected()
Current selection state.
|
void |
setEnabled(boolean state)
Enable flag.
|
void |
setLabel(java.lang.String label)
Shape group label.
|
void |
setMeta(java.util.Map<java.lang.String,java.lang.String> meta)
Shape group meta data.
|
void |
setSelected(boolean state)
Current selection state.
|
protected ShapeGroup(long cPtr,
boolean cMemoryOwn)
public ShapeGroup(ShapeGroup shape_group)
protected static long getCPtr(ShapeGroup obj)
protected void finalize()
finalize in class java.lang.Objectpublic void delete()
public void close()
close in interface java.lang.AutoCloseablepublic int getKey()
public void setLabel(java.lang.String label)
public java.lang.String getLabel()
public void setEnabled(boolean state)
public boolean isEnabled()
public void setSelected(boolean state)
public boolean isSelected()
public void setMeta(java.util.Map<java.lang.String,java.lang.String> meta)
public java.util.Map<java.lang.String,java.lang.String> getMeta()